# -*- coding: utf-8 -*-
"""
Created on Thu May 14 19:43:45 2020
@author: hurva
"""
from mpl_toolkits.mplot3d import Axes3D
import numpy as np
import matplotlib.pylab as plt
import copy
########
## Need to change the name of all the constant for the sake of concistency
## because I have not followed the convention. Example beta is usually infectivity
## but i used the name alpha.
####
## The alphaEff is the effective infectivity because of seasonality. alpha is
## the baserate, alpha1 is the strength of the "seasonality"
##
def susStep(N, t, sus, inf, rem, alpha, alpha1, gamma, B, d, h=0.01):
alphaEff = alpha*(1+alpha1*np.cos(np.pi*2*t))
return sus + (B*N + gamma*rem - d*sus -alphaEff*inf*sus/N)*h
def expStep(N, t, exp, sus, inf, alpha, alpha1, beta, delta, d, h=0.01):
alphaEff = alpha*(1+alpha1*np.cos(np.pi*2*t))
return exp + (alphaEff*inf*sus/N - (delta + d)*exp)*h
def infStep(exp, inf, alpha, beta, delta, d, h=0.01):
return inf + (delta*exp - (beta + d)*inf)*h
def remStep(rem, inf, beta, gamma, d,h=0.01):
return rem + (beta*inf - (gamma + d)*rem)*h
def timeStep(susMat, infMat, remMat, expMat, t, alpha, alpha1, beta, gamma, delta, B, d, h=0.01):
tempSus = np.copy(susMat)
tempInf = np.copy(infMat)
tempRem = np.copy(remMat)
tempExp = np.copy(expMat)
for i, row in enumerate(susMat):
for j, col in enumerate(row):
N = susMat[i,j] + remMat[i,j] + infMat[i,j] + expMat[i,j]
tempSus[i,j] = susStep(N, t, susMat[i,j], infMat[i,j], remMat[i,j], alpha, alpha1, gamma, B, d, h)
tempInf[i,j] = infStep(expMat[i,j], infMat[i,j], alpha, beta, delta, d, h)
tempRem[i,j] = remStep(remMat[i,j], infMat[i,j], beta, gamma, d, h)
tempExp[i,j] = expStep(N, t, expMat[i,j], susMat[i,j], infMat[i,j], alpha, alpha1, beta, delta, d, h)
return tempSus, tempInf, tempRem, tempExp, t
